Ultra Miami was just cancelled yesterday that was scheduled for the 20th of march i think, Tomorrowland Winter was also cancelled as well as a few others.

There is a good article in Billboard regarding the possibility of many festivals being cancelled including Coachella, the Billboard article talks about clauses in the contracts that promoters do not have to pay the artist if its an Act of God and how some artist demand to be paid regardless because they take out insurance for cancellations but supposedly acts of god are not covered.
